How they compare

Oman currently reports 9,617 kilowatt-hours against 9,253 kilowatt-hours in Aruba, a difference of 364 kilowatt-hours.

The two have swapped places 1 time across 25 shared years of data; in 2000 it was Aruba ahead.

Aruba ranks 24th and Oman ranks 21st of 214 countries.

Aruba has averaged higher in every one of the 3 decades both report.

Head to head by decade

Decade Aruba Oman Difference Ahead
2000s 9,298 kilowatt-hours 5,086 kilowatt-hours 4,211 kilowatt-hours Aruba
2010s 9,169 kilowatt-hours 7,574 kilowatt-hours 1,595 kilowatt-hours Aruba
2020s 9,261 kilowatt-hours 8,946 kilowatt-hours 315.63 kilowatt-hours Aruba

Averages of every year both report within each decade.
